Over the years, the numbering system of bars steel has been the problems which steel bars production enterprises do not resolve well. At present, companies mainly rely on manual measurement to complete the task of bar steel counting. Sometimes a group of bars on the need for regular counting and verification, this is heavy workload. And the long time counting work will cause worker physical exhaustion and more errors. Therefore, the development and research of bars automatically counting system is an urgent need to be resolved. It mainly study on the bar identification and count system from following parts in this paper, put up laboratory equipment similar to industrial environment, image preprocessing, comparative image by edge detection experiment, DALSA software redevelopment and the counting of objective image. Laboratory equipment in accordance with the industry to design, make it essential to achieve the standard. In the image preprocessing methods, it introduced processing methods based on mathematical morphology:removing image background noise、 image enhancement, image smoothing, image sharpening、image filtering. It makes the image preprocessing effect better. At the same time,it also resolved the uneven binary image caused by uneven illumination in the images collection process, which image enhancement, smoothing, sharpening and filtering are main problems in study. Provision to the image on the basis of equalization in the histogram, find the most suitable for transformation of the functions and increase contrast of the image in order to enhance the image.The main purpose of smoothing is remove noise.Sharpening is prominent to main objectives.And the main purpose of filtering eliminates shadows that are mainly caused by uneven light.This experiment is done in uniform lighting conditions.Presented in the bar section is similar gray value.And significantly difference with the background. Therefore, the method of image segmentation to binary image processing is used in the edge detection experiment. It uses a number of typical bar image edge detection methods to analyze. By experiment comparison, Canny algorithm is a more successful method.Whether noise removal or edge detection are very successful. Finally, the image edge detection to detect targets in the class circle.A new algorithm of Blob is used. It is a class of circle center to determine the class round the edge of the rectangular outline of the external characteristics such as the identification principle and recognition algorithms to meet certain requirements of independence of the regional round for the class object recognition.
